The first issue of PassiFlora is almost fully devoted to the upcoming holidays. Here is a snapshot of the different categories and content:
Articles
Read about ideas for vegetarian and vegan potluck dinner, green gift-wrapping, as well as ways to spend your free time during the holidays and share your joy with the loved ones. The column “Vegetables of the month” will help you make sense of your root vegetables and provide you with all the useful information about parsnips and turnips.
Recipes
PassiFlora focuses on vegetarian and vegan food. The first issue features a collection of our favorite seasonal Recipes. Check out our soups, salads, side dishes, and desserts.
Fresh
Fresh section of the magazine is all about useful tips and tricks. We are starting a collection of illustrated kitchen tips. We also share tricks on eco-friendly Christmas decorations. Finally this section features a column on ingenious use of every-day objects. Look how you can use a simple apple as part of your holiday decor.
Craft
The Craft section of the first issue features instructions for the seasonal origami models as well as the links to the origami websites. It also provides you with the patterns and instructions to different projects mentioned throughout other sections.
